The Tamil film industry is abuzz with excitement as an X post recently confirmed a landmark reunion: A.R. Rahman and S.J. Suryah are teaming up once again for the upcoming film Killer, marking their fifth collaboration — and their first in over a decade.
This collaboration is both nostalgic and surprising. Their last joint project was nearly ten years ago, and their partnership began with the 2004 cult romantic sci-fi film New, which despite mixed critical reception, became a commercial success. According to Box Office India, New grossed over ₹20 crore — a significant achievement for its time, powered in large part by Rahman’s chart-topping soundtrack.
A Reunion Years in the Making
Rahman and Suryah’s cinematic chemistry is well documented. After New, the duo went on to work together on films like Isai and Anbe Aaruyire, each pairing showcasing Rahman’s ability to elevate Suryah’s offbeat narratives with emotionally charged, genre-bending music. The upcoming film Killer will be their fifth project together, rekindling what fans often call a “musical magic duo.”Given Rahman’s limited engagements in Tamil cinema in recent years — averaging only 2 to 3 Tamil projects annually since 2020, per a 2023 Film Companion interview — his signing for Killer is a major coup. Industry insiders suggest this may be tied to the film’s pan-Indian, multilingual ambitions, with Killer being prepped for release in Tamil, Telugu, Hindi, and Malayalam.
Killer Promises Musical and Visual Intrigue
The recently unveiled first-look poster is a striking visual statement: bold red hues, a stylized gold-plated weapon, and the Tamil phrase "Isai Puyal" (translated as “Music Storm”), a title long associated with A.R. Rahman, hint at the tone of the movie. The imagery suggests a high-octane thriller fused with intense emotional beats — a territory Rahman has navigated expertly in his decades-long career.
With Rahman's global reputation — including an Oscar win for Slumdog Millionaire's "Jai Ho" in 2009 — his presence signals that Killer is not just a regional venture, but a film with international musical appeal and cinematic scope.
What Makes Killer Stand Out?
-
S.J. Suryah, known for his unconventional storytelling and screen presence, is said to be playing a dual-shaded lead.
-
The teaser campaign, starting with the cryptic “Guess the Killer Composer,” created significant online buzz and fan theories before the big reveal of Rahman.
-
Produced in collaboration with Angel Studios, the film may also have international production ties, reflecting the increasing globalization of Indian regional cinema.
